NDRC Issues 15th Five-Year Plan for Circular Economy, Targets 8 Trillion Yuan by 2030

The National Development and Reform Commission has issued the 15th Five-Year Plan for Circular Economy Development, targeting an output value of 8 trillion yuan from the resource recycling industry by 2030. The plan aims to raise main resource productivity by about 16% from 2025 levels, when it was already 77% higher than in 2012. It also outlines measures to improve recycling of spent power batteries, wind turbines, and photovoltaic panels as large-scale decommissioning begins.

Recycling one tonne of spent power batteries yields 200 to 300 kilograms of metals such as lithium, nickel and cobalt, while extracting the same amount from virgin ore requires 20 to 30 tonnes of ore and generates energy consumption and emissions in the process. Circular economy is centred on efficient resource use and recycling, following the principles of reduce, reuse and recycle to create a closed-loop model of resource–product–renewed resource. In 2025, main resource productivity was about 77% higher than in 2012, while energy and water consumption per unit of GDP fell sharply.

The National Development and Reform Commission recently issued the 15th Five-Year Plan for Circular Economy Development, setting a target for the resource recycling industry to achieve an output value of RMB 8 trillion by 2030 and for main resource productivity to rise by about 16% from 2025 levels. The plan includes a section on improving the recycling system for the so-called new three categories of solid waste—spent power batteries, decommissioned wind turbines and retired photovoltaic panels—and addresses the recycling gaps in these categories.

During the 15th Five-Year Plan period, China will enter a phase of large-scale decommissioning of the new three categories of equipment. While the recycling network for waste products and equipment is improving, the standardisation of recycling practices needs to be enhanced, and there are still gaps in pollution control technical specifications for the new three categories. In response to the long-standing problem of missing paying entities for wind and solar equipment recycling, the plan requires that retired equipment be handed over to qualified circular economy enterprises for proper disposal, helping to establish a commercial closed loop that internalises costs from the source.

In practice, some companies reuse old batteries for backup power in communication base stations after precise testing and sorting, while others use artificial intelligence algorithms to assess battery health, significantly reducing testing costs. Embedding digital and intelligent tools into the recycling, tracing and processing stages helps drive the development of the circular economy industry into a new sector with high-tech attributes.
